The seventies brought a massive increase in the use of plastics in motor vehicles and accordingly Uticolor created materials and repair techniques to bond, weld and finish these plastics. The eighties saw a resurgence of leather upholstery in both motor vehicles and domestic furniture. Uticolor adapted again by developing its own leather repair materials and processes. It was at this time Keith's son Lindsay took on a managerial role with the company after working as a Uticolor sub-contractor in the field and studying plastics and surface coatings. In more recent years Uticolor has formulated range of highly specialised water-based coatings that perform to the exacting standards of product performance required for modern leather finishes. It is this technology that allows Uticolor technicians to regularly service the furnishing needs of clients such as Australian Parliament Buildings, The High Court and The Reserve Bank of Australia. Not forgetting our roots, our repairers are just as willing and able to attend to the needs of individual clients and households should even a small nick or cut might need attention. Sadly, founder Keith Smith passed away in 2009 but he has left behind him Australia's premier mobile plastic and vinyl repair service whose franchisees take pride in their standard of work, the sharing knowledge within the system and our achievements over the passage of time. Today Uticolor is a truly comprehensive mobile repair service supplying specialised skills to the motor vehicle and furniture trades as well as to many diverse industries where plastics and coatings are used. We are proud to say that our first franchisee has only just retired after working with us for over forty years.
